Python is a programming language that has gained significant popularity in the financial sector. Adopted by major investment banks and hedge funds, it is used to develop a wide array of financial applications, from core trading systems to risk management platforms.

The KNIME Analytics Platform is a premier open-source solution for data-driven innovation, enabling users to uncover the potential within their data, extract valuable insights, and forecast future trends. Featuring over 1,000 modules, hundreds of ready-to-run examples, an extensive array of integrated tools, and a broad selection of advanced algorithms, KNIME Analytics Platform is an indispensable resource for any data scientist or business analyst.
